Shefki Kuqi's early header gave Swansea an important 1-0 win at Watford which had ramifications at both ends of the Coca-Cola Championship table.
The former Ipswich striker had already spurned two good chances when he headed the winner at Vicarage Road as Paulo Sousa's side strengthened their hold on a play-off place.
However, the visitors were indebted to a pair of goal-line clearances from skipper Alan Tate as they shut out Watford - who are now right in the thick of a battle against relegation.
Malky Mackay's side find themselves just two points above the relegation zone in a congested table and will need to make the most of the visit of doomed Peterborough on Saturday to stave off the threat of the drop into League One.
Kuqi capped a frenetic first 45 minutes in which both sides should have scored at least twice with the solitary goal as the Swans made it an incredible 23 goals conceded in 35 league games.
